The Pololu Stepper Motor: Unipolar/Bipolar, 200 Steps/Rev, 57×56mm, 3.6V, 2 A/Phase is a versatile NEMA 23-size hybrid stepping motor suitable for both unipolar and bipolar configurations. It features a precise 1.8° step angle, translating to 200 steps per revolution, which ensures accurate positioning and smooth operation. The motor is designed to draw 2 A per phase at a voltage of 3.6 V, providing a robust holding torque of 9 kg-cm.
This motor is equipped with six color-coded wires with bare leads, facilitating easy integration with various stepper motor drivers. In unipolar mode, all six leads are utilized, while in bipolar mode, the center-tap wires can be left disconnected, allowing for flexible control options. The motor’s construction includes a 56.4 mm square frame and a 56 mm length, with a shaft diameter of 6.35 mm, supported by two ball bearings for enhanced durability and performance.
For optimal performance, it is recommended to operate this motor in bipolar mode using a high-power stepper motor driver. This configuration maximizes the motor’s capabilities, ensuring efficient and reliable operation in demanding applications.

- Dimensions: 56.4 x 56 x 56 mm (not including the shaft)

PDF File
- Weight: 0.7 kg (25 oz)
- Shaft diameter: 6.35 mm (0.25″) “D”
- Steps per revolution: 200
- Current rating: 2 A per coil
- Voltage rating: 3.6 V
- Resistance: 1.8 Ω per coil
- Holding torque: 9 kg-cm (125 oz-in)
- Inductance: 2.5 mH per coil
- Lead length: 30 cm (12″)
- Output shaft supported by two ball bearings
